14 What good is it, my brothers and sisters,
If someone claims to have Faith
But has No Deeds?
Can such Faith Save them?
15 Suppose a brother or a sister
Is without clothes and daily food.
16 If one of you says to them,
“Go in Peace; Keep Warm and Well Fed,”
But does Nothing about their Physical Needs,
What Good is it?
17 In the same way,
Faith by itself,
If it is not Accompanied by Action,
IS DEAD.
18 But someone will say,
“You have Faith; I have Deeds.”
Show me your Faith without Deeds,
And I will show you my Faith by my Deeds.
19 You believe that there is One God.
Good!
Even the Demons Believe that—and Shudder.
20 You Foolish person,
Do you want Evidence
That Faith without Deeds is Useless?
21 Was not our father Abraham
Considered Righteous for what he did
When he Offered his son Isaac on the Alter?
22 You see that his Faith
And his Actions were working Together,
And his Faith was made Complete by what he Did.
23 And the Scripture was Fulfilled
That says “Abraham believed God,
And it was Credited to him as Righteousness,”
And he was Called God’s Friend.
24 You see that a person is Considered Righteous
By what they Do and not by Faith Alone.
25 In the same way,
Was not even Rahab the prostitute
Considered Righteous for what she Did
When she gave Lodging to the Spies
And sent them off in a different direction?
26 As the body without the Spirit is Dead,
So Faith Without Deeds is Dead.
(James 2:14-26, NIV)
